Uncertain times are a certainty in leadership. Whether it’s economic volatility, organizational shifts, or global instability, leaders consistently encounter a high degree of uncertainty. Today, business leaders must navigate unpredictable complexities while maintaining confidence and clarity. In this timely episode of The Leadership Habit Podcast, host Jenn DeWall welcomed CEO Scott Marshall.

I wanted to bring people’s attention to the fact that NICEC Journal 54 is now available on the journal’s website. The NICEC journal is a free, open access journal that brings together policy, research and practice. The latest issue features articles on higher education careers practice, the use of digital technologies in careers work, career counselling for domestic violence survivors, career coaching and adult guidance, and career theory.
